
在Excel中编辑拼音并加声调,可以通过使用Alt代码、插入特殊符号、拼音输入法、以及VBA宏进行自动化处理。本文将逐一详细介绍这些方法,帮助你熟练掌握在Excel中编辑拼音并加上声调的技巧。
一、使用Alt代码
Alt代码是一种通过键盘快捷键输入特殊字符的方法。在Excel中,你可以使用Alt代码来输入带有声调的拼音字符。具体方法如下:
- 打开Excel文件并选择需要输入拼音的单元格。
- 按住Alt键,然后在小键盘上输入相应的代码。例如,按住Alt键并输入“0225”来输入“á”。
- 松开Alt键,你会看到带有声调的拼音字符出现在单元格中。
常用拼音字符的Alt代码
| 字符 | Alt代码 |
|---|---|
| ā | 0257 |
| á | 0225 |
| ǎ | 462 |
| à | 0224 |
| ē | 0275 |
| é | 0233 |
| ě | 283 |
| è | 0232 |
| ī | 0299 |
| í | 0237 |
| ǐ | 464 |
| ì | 0236 |
| ō | 0333 |
| ó | 0243 |
| ǒ | 466 |
| ò | 0242 |
| ū | 0363 |
| ú | 0250 |
| ǔ | 468 |
| ù | 0249 |
| ü | 0252 |
| ǘ | 470 |
| ǚ | 472 |
| ǜ | 474 |
通过Alt代码,你可以快速输入常用的拼音字符。不过,这种方法在需要输入大量拼音时可能不够高效。
二、插入特殊符号
Excel提供了插入特殊符号的功能,可以帮助你轻松输入带有声调的拼音字符。具体步骤如下:
- 打开Excel文件并选择需要输入拼音的单元格。
- 点击“插入”选项卡,然后选择“符号”。
- 在弹出的符号对话框中,选择“字体”下拉菜单,选择“Arial”或其他常见字体。
- 在子集下拉菜单中,选择“拉丁语补充”或“拉丁语扩展-A”。
- 找到需要的拼音字符,点击“插入”,然后关闭符号对话框。
优点和缺点
这种方法适用于输入少量拼音字符,操作相对简单,但在需要大量输入时同样不够高效。
三、使用拼音输入法
使用拼音输入法可以直接输入带有声调的拼音字符。具体步骤如下:
- 安装拼音输入法(如搜狗拼音、微软拼音等)。
- 切换到拼音输入法,输入拼音并按数字键选择带有声调的字符。例如,输入“a1”选择“ā”。
- 将拼音字符复制到Excel单元格中。
优点和缺点
拼音输入法适用于需要频繁输入拼音的场景,可以提高输入效率。但需要一定的熟悉和练习。
四、使用VBA宏进行自动化处理
如果需要在Excel中大量输入和编辑拼音字符,使用VBA宏进行自动化处理是一个高效的解决方案。以下是一个简单的VBA宏示例,帮助你快速插入带有声调的拼音字符:
Sub InsertPinyin()
Dim pinyin As String
Dim cell As Range
For Each cell In Selection
pinyin = cell.Value
pinyin = Replace(pinyin, "a1", "ā")
pinyin = Replace(pinyin, "a2", "á")
pinyin = Replace(pinyin, "a3", "ǎ")
pinyin = Replace(pinyin, "a4", "à")
pinyin = Replace(pinyin, "e1", "ē")
pinyin = Replace(pinyin, "e2", "é")
pinyin = Replace(pinyin, "e3", "ě")
pinyin = Replace(pinyin, "e4", "è")
pinyin = Replace(pinyin, "i1", "ī")
pinyin = Replace(pinyin, "i2", "í")
pinyin = Replace(pinyin, "i3", "ǐ")
pinyin = Replace(pinyin, "i4", "ì")
pinyin = Replace(pinyin, "o1", "ō")
pinyin = Replace(pinyin, "o2", "ó")
pinyin = Replace(pinyin, "o3", "ǒ")
pinyin = Replace(pinyin, "o4", "ò")
pinyin = Replace(pinyin, "u1", "ū")
pinyin = Replace(pinyin, "u2", "ú")
pinyin = Replace(pinyin, "u3", "ǔ")
pinyin = Replace(pinyin, "u4", "ù")
pinyin = Replace(pinyin, "v1", "ǖ")
pinyin = Replace(pinyin, "v2", "ǘ")
pinyin = Replace(pinyin, "v3", "ǚ")
pinyin = Replace(pinyin, "v4", "ǜ")
cell.Value = pinyin
Next cell
End Sub
使用方法
- 打开Excel文件,按
Alt + F11打开VBA编辑器。 - 在VBA编辑器中,插入一个新模块,并将上面的代码粘贴进去。
- 关闭VBA编辑器,返回Excel。
- 选择需要转换的单元格,按
Alt + F8运行宏“InsertPinyin”。
优点和缺点
使用VBA宏可以大大提高输入效率,适用于大量拼音字符的输入和编辑。不过,VBA宏的编写和调试需要一定的编程基础。
总结
在Excel中编辑拼音并加声调的方法有很多种,包括使用Alt代码、插入特殊符号、拼音输入法和VBA宏。每种方法各有优缺点,可以根据实际需求选择最适合的方法。如果需要输入大量拼音字符,建议使用拼音输入法或VBA宏进行自动化处理,以提高工作效率。掌握这些方法后,你将能够更加高效地在Excel中编辑和处理拼音字符。
相关问答FAQs:
1. 如何在Excel中编辑拼音并添加声调?
在Excel中编辑拼音并添加声调可以通过以下步骤实现:
2. 如何在Excel中输入拼音?
在Excel单元格中输入拼音可以直接使用英文字母输入。例如,如果要输入“zhong”,只需在单元格中键入“zhong”。
3. 如何在Excel中为拼音添加声调?
要为拼音添加声调,可以使用Excel的内置函数,如“拼音函数”。在要添加声调的单元格中,输入以下公式:=拼音(A1,4)。其中,A1代表包含拼音的单元格,4表示添加声调。按下回车键后,将显示带有声调的拼音。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4275570